MacBook Air (M1)

                                        MacBook Air (M1)


If you’re interested in a lightweight MacBook but the Air is out of your price range, you’re probably better suited to 2020’s M1 MacBook Air, which Apple is continuing to sell. The base model, which includes 8GB of RAM and 256 GB of storage, starts at $999. 

The older Air has a 13.3-inch 2560 x 1600 screen, Touch ID, 720p webcam, fingerprint sensor, and scissor-switch keyboard. 

The M1, while not being quite as fast as the M2, is still fast. In our testing, it handled intense photo- and video-editing workloads better than almost any Intel-powered thin-and-light laptop we’ve tried this year. It was also able to run Shadow of the Tomb Raider at close-to-playable frame rates, which is quite a feat for integrated graphics.

Battery life is also not quite as good as that of the M2, but it’s very close. We got between eight and 10 hours of sustained work.
